Quick Answer
Live Chaat Counter Experiences are professionally managed food activations where trained chefs prepare and serve classic Indian street snacks — pani puri, bhel puri, dahi papdi, sev puri, and more — live in front of guests at an event. In Kochi, these counters are popular at weddings, sangeets, corporate events, and birthday parties. They typically cost between ₹80 and ₹220 per person depending on the number of items, décor, and staffing, and can be scaled for gatherings of 50 to 1,000-plus guests.

Popular Chaat Items and Customisation Options Available in Kochi
A well-designed customised chaat menu service in Kochi typically includes five to eight items spanning different textures and heat levels so every guest finds something they love. The classic line-up starts with pani puri or golgappa — always a crowd favourite — followed by bhel puri, sev puri, dahi papdi chaat, aloo tikki, and raj kachori. Many Kochi-based caterers now also offer fusion additions such as Kerala-style chaat with coconut-based chutneys, Mexican bhel, or cheese-topped sev puri to suit cosmopolitan guest lists. An interactive chaat station setup gives the chef room to improvise: guests can ask for extra pomegranate seeds, choose between sweet and spicy pani, or have their dahi chaat assembled without onion for dietary reasons. This live interaction is the heart of what makes Live Chaat Counter Experiences so memorable compared to a regular buffet. For events with international guests or corporate clients unfamiliar with street food, the counter staff can explain each item, turning food into a cultural storytelling moment. Jain-friendly and gluten-sensitive versions of several items can also be arranged with advance notice, which is important for diverse Kochi guest lists that often include guests from different parts of India and abroad. The live street food counter format naturally supports this kind of flexible, on-the-spot customisation in a way that plated service simply cannot.
How Much Do Live Chaat Counter Experiences Cost in Kochi?
Pricing for Live Chaat Counter Experiences in Kochi varies based on the number of menu items, the duration of service, décor of the stall, and the number of chefs deployed. For a basic three-item counter serving up to 100 guests for two hours, you can expect to pay roughly ₹8,000 to ₹15,000 for the entire setup. A mid-range interactive chaat station setup with five to six items, themed décor, printed menu boards, and two chefs for a 200-guest event typically costs between ₹20,000 and ₹35,000. Premium packages with branded stalls, eight-plus items, clay pots or leaf-plate serving, live music accompaniment, and three or more staff can range from ₹40,000 to ₹70,000 depending on the venue location — central areas like MG Road and Marine Drive tend to attract slightly higher logistics costs than peripheral venues. Per-plate pricing, which many Kochi caterers prefer for larger events, generally falls between ₹80 and ₹220 per person. Destination weddings at resorts around Kumarakom or Alleppey that hire Kochi-based caterers will see a 10–20% travel and logistics premium. The customised chaat menu service tier — where you co-design the menu, choose themed crockery, and add fusion items — sits at the upper end of the range and is most popular for high-profile corporate events and destination weddings. Always clarify whether the quote includes chutney stations, serving wear, and post-event cleanup, as these can add ₹3,000 to ₹8,000 if billed separately.
Venue Compatibility: Where Can You Set Up a Live Chaat Counter in Kochi?
One of the practical advantages of a live street food counter is its adaptability to different venue types across Kochi. Banquet halls in Edapally, Aluva, and Kakkanad typically have dedicated pre-function areas or open foyers where a chaat counter can be set up without disrupting the main dining arrangement. Open-air lawns at wedding resorts in Cherai or Munambam are ideal because the gentle sea breeze and natural ambience enhance the street-food feeling. Rooftop venues at Kochi's boutique hotels near Fort Kochi and Mattancherry are increasingly popular for sunset sangeets, where Live Chaat Counter Experiences serve as the evening snack entertainment while guests enjoy the skyline. Heritage venues in the Jewish Quarter and Dutch Palace precinct pair beautifully with Mughal or Old Delhi-themed chaat stalls for an evocative cultural contrast. For home events such as naamkaran, housewarming, or engagement ceremonies in residential areas like Panampilly Nagar, Vytilla, or Palarivattom, a compact single-chef counter requiring as little as 4×6 feet of floor space can be arranged. The only venue types that require special planning are air-conditioned closed halls with strict smoke policies, where the tawa setup must use induction-based equipment rather than gas. Confirm ventilation capacity with your venue manager before finalising the chaat live cooking station format.
How Do You Choose the Right Provider for Live Chaat Counter Experiences in Kochi?
Choosing the right caterer for Live Chaat Counter Experiences in Kochi requires looking beyond price. Start with guest engagement food experience as a core criterion: ask the provider to share videos or photographs from their recent events showing how guests interact with the counter, because a skilled chaat chef who engages with guests makes a visible difference to the energy of the event. Verify that the provider can deliver a properly licensed food operation — FSSAI registration is mandatory for commercial catering in Kerala, and any reputable vendor will share this document without hesitation. Ask specifically about sourcing: the best Kochi-based chaat counters use fresh tamarind, hand-ground spice blends, and locally sourced coriander rather than commercial ready-mix pastes, and you can usually taste the difference in the chutney depth. Kerala wedding catering trends increasingly favour organic and locally sourced ingredients, so providers who align with this values-led approach tend to score higher with discerning hosts. Request a tasting session — most established providers in Kochi offer one — and use it to assess spice calibration, chutney balance, and puri crunch. Also evaluate the stall décor samples: is it cohesive with your event theme? Can they customise the counter banners and crockery to match your wedding palette? Finally, check cancellation and weather contingency policies, especially for outdoor events during Kochi's monsoon months from June to August. A trustworthy provider will have a covered canopy backup plan already in their proposal.

💰 Cost / Quality Factors
- Number of menu items: each additional item typically adds ₹10–₹30 per guest to the overall cost of the customised chaat menu service.
- Guest count: per-plate pricing decreases at scale — larger events above 400 guests often attract 10–15% volume discounts.
- Duration of service: extending beyond the standard two-hour window usually incurs an hourly surcharge of ₹1,500–₹3,000 per chef.
- Venue location and accessibility: venues in Ernakulam city are generally easier and cheaper to service than island or backwater resort locations.
- Décor complexity: a branded or fully themed stall with printed banners, fairy lights, and custom crockery adds ₹5,000–₹20,000 to the base package.
- Ingredient quality: organic, locally sourced, or speciality ingredients cost more upfront but measurably improve the quality of the live street food counter output.
⚠️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Booking based on price alone without tasting the food first — chutney quality and puri crispness vary enormously between providers.
- Underestimating guest throughput and booking only one counter for 200-plus guests, which creates long queues and reduces the quality of Live Chaat Counter Experiences.
- Placing the chaat counter directly next to the main dinner buffet, which causes congestion; position it at least 15–20 feet away in a separate zone.
- Failing to account for Kochi's monsoon weather when booking outdoor events between June and August without a covered contingency plan.
- Not specifying dietary requirements in advance, resulting in last-minute menu adjustments that slow service during peak event hours.
- Ignoring cleanup responsibilities in the contract — some providers do not include post-event waste management, leaving you with unexpected costs and venue penalties.
